COMMUNIQUE
The Peace and Security Council of the African Union (AU), at its 375th meeting held on
10 May 2013, adopted the following decision on the situation in Somalia:
Council,
1. Takes note of the briefing made by the Commissioner for Peace and Security on the
situation in Somalia and the outcome of the Somalia Conference held in London on 7 May
2013. Council also takes note of the statements made by the representatives of the Federal
Republic of Somalia, Ethiopia, in its capacity as the Chair of the Inter‐Governmental
Authority on Development (IGAD), the United Nations, the European Union, France, the
United Kingdom and the United States;
2. Welcomes the recent developments in Somalia, in particular the political progress made
and the steps being taken to resolve outstanding constitutional issues. In this regard,
Council welcomes the Federal Government’s initiatives to engage regional authorities
through outreach and dialogue, in order to foster national reconciliation and unity, as well
as the efforts to rebuild the armed forces, integrate militias and address the issue of
disengaged fighters. Council also welcomes the agreement for dialogue signed between
President Hassan Sheikh Mohamud and President Ahmed Silanyo of Somaliland;
3. Welcomes the outcomes of the 7 May Somalia Conference held in London and calls for
effective follow‐up. In this respect, Council urges all concerned partners to honor the
commitments made;
4. Commends AMISOM for its continued efforts to further peace, security and stability in
Somalia. Council calls for greater support to AMISOM, particularly with respect to force
multipliers and enablers, to enable the Mission, with the support of the Somalia national
security forces, consolidate the progress made on the ground and further extend areas
under the control of the Somali authorities. In this regard, Council urges the United Nations
and other partners to assist in responding to these needs;
5. Requests the Commission to submit a report, within 30 days, on the issues raised in UN
Security Council resolution 2093(2013), including its response to the United Nations
Security Council;
